Transaction 0b3580aa1505c328f4b0ffbac839a65695f65bc95fd37f357c81a9d3a5465870
1 Input
1 Output
-
0b3580aa1505c328f4b0ffbac839a65695f65bc95fd37f357c81a9d3a5465870:0
- value
- 690287
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 327c36630f1a9a76ba2d2c22643ee0ac97a49469 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15bwb2NzsbmRLhPHTbRThtzpvECg4RAkj8